This is a VS2005 C++ LSP hook project that has a few bugs that need to be fixed. It allows specified programs to have their Internet traffic redirected via a proxy IP and port. It was originally made in VS2003 and ported to VS2005.
There are 2 .dll files, one to install/remove the LSP hook and one to manage the web traffic that passes through an application. There is also a test .exe to use the functions of the .dll files.
There are 3 issues:
1. It is very slow to install the hook on Windows Vista (the VS2003 version was not slow on Vista).
2. It crashes on 64 bit Windows (XP, Vista). The VS2003 version worked on 64 bit Windows (see [login to view URL]).
3. It sometimes causes Windows to become unstable or crash. Sometimes it conflicts with software like Norton and McAfee. Please look into if the LSP is being installed, used, and removed correctly, try to figure out what would cause this.
